This morning we had a Power outage from the thunderstorm that blew threw, so I decided to cook breakfast using my homemade "Jet Stove".
I used it last month to make Italian Sausages and Peppers, they turn out great.
This morning I used it in my fireplace, there is no smoke since the jet stove burns all of the wood gases.
I made Breakfast Taco's with: Toasted Tortilla's, Bacon, Refried Beans, scrambled eggs, cheese and salsa. 2 -hours start to finish.
I Swear, the second I had the taco in my hand the power came back on ... lol
Still, this proved we were ready for anything, we are Preppers and have enough preps for years. As a family, everyone knew their task, like getting firewood, or the campfire cast iron skillets, ect... ect...
